A 54-year-old pastor from Cedar Grove is assisting police with investigations after nearly 60 pounds of suspected cannabis was seized at V.C. Bird International Airport on Saturday.

Dean Robert Gould arrived on American Airlines Flight AA2579 on 13 June when officers attached to the police K9 unit reportedly identified two duffle bags belonging to him for further inspection.

Police said a search uncovered 60 packages containing a green vegetable substance believed to be cannabis. The packages were allegedly concealed beneath clothing and footwear inside the luggage.

The substance weighed approximately 59.5 pounds and has an estimated street value of EC$357,000.

Investigators also found packages bearing the name Jahmai Gould and a Bronx, New York address. Authorities said they are examining the significance of that discovery as part of ongoing inquiries.

Gould, a United States citizen born in Antigua and Barbuda, was taken into custody for questioning. He is expected to be charged on Monday.

Police investigations continue.
